Barak decides to open Gaza crossings for passage of humanitarian supplies

Defense Minister Ehud Barak on Monday decided to open the crossings to the Gaza Strip and allow through humanitarian supplies, including medicine, food and fuel, throughout the day, The Defense Ministry said in a statement. The decision was made following consultations with various officials, including Barak deputy, Matan Vilna'i, the statement said. The crossings to the Strip have been closed since November 5 due to Palestinian rocket fire at the western negev.
